How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sunnyside Staten Island?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sunnyside Staten Island Studio Apartments | $2,197 | $1,516 | $2,879 |
| Sunnyside Staten Island 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,172 | $1,848 | $3,825 |
| Sunnyside Staten Island 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,068 | $2,500 | $5,950 |
| Sunnyside Staten Island 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,383 | $2,900 | $3,650 |
